Leave No Man Behind: The Saga of Combat Search and Rescue Appomattox Learning a foreign language isBeginning with the birth of combat aircraft in World War I and the early attempts to rescue warriors trapped behind enemy lines, Leave No Man Behind chronicles in depth nearly one hundred years of combat search and rescue (CSAR). All major U. S. combat operations from World War II to the early years of the Iraq War are covered, including previously classified missions and several Medal of Honor winning operations.
